Quinta do Vale Golf Resort, 20th October 2012

It was more luck than judgement that we chose Quinta Do Vale this week. With the central Algarve still busy with residue golfers here for the Portugal Masters it would have been near impossible to increase the tee times to the numbers that we required. In the end we had x24 players many of whom had never played the Sevy Ballesteros designed course. A combination of six Par 3’s, six Par 4’s and six Par 5’s that look out over the Guadiana River to Spain it is well worth a visit especially if you nip over the border and fill the car up with fuel which is much cheaper either that and/or buy some nice Rioja!

Blue skies greeted us after a week of indifferent weather. It was a return back to the individual format with two nearest the pins and everybody had the option of a complimentary buggy. A great deal on offer today through the Society considering it is high season. Few scores made it into the thirties which indicated how hard many found this course.
